The Opportunity:


We are seeking a skilled and detail-oriented Lead Hardware Production Technician to join our dynamic production this role you will be responsible for a group of highly skilled Technicians that perform assembling testing and troubleshooting electronic and mechanical hardware components used in our products. You will work closely with engineers and other production staff to ensure that all components meet quality standards and are produced in an efficient timely manner.

Responsibilities:

  • Manage the Production Assembly team by assigning tasks setting priorities and monitoring progress.
  • Provide guidance support and training to the team members helping them improve their skills quality and productivity.
  • Work as an individual contributor at times while mentoring more junior team members.
  • Will be responsible for maintaining the assembly departments equipment tools and ensuring compliance for calibration.
  • Will act as the assembly departments SME (Subject Matter Expert) to review and approve work instructions and procedures for supporting programs and product realization through the production process.
  • Mechanically assemble complex electronic systems including high-quality wire harnesses test racks and components with tasks such as hand soldering and component fabrication within a team or autonomously as tasks dictate
  • Perform validation and testing of various electronic components using equipment such as multi-meters oscilloscopes network analyzers and test racks while conducting functional tests identifying issues and provide or implement solutions as directed.
  • Ensure that all checklists are thoroughly completed reviewed and finalized before submitting them to Quality Assurance (QA) for approval
  • Hold the Assembly team accountable for quality performance and compliance.


Qualifications:

  • Must be a US Citizen.
  • Bachelors degree in Engineering or equivalent related technical experience.
  • Proficient with common hand tools and power tools such as pliers wrenches screwdrivers calipers crimping tools soldering & desoldering stations multi meters or specialized test equipment
  • Has a strong understanding of 3-phase AC power (120/240V) and DC power including their characteristics applications and safe handling practices in electrical systems
  • Able to read and interpret wiring diagrams and follow assembly instruction verify drawings and equipment layouts
  • Possesses a working knowledge of computers with proficiency in various operating systems and a preference for experience with Linux OS
  • Physically able to lift 50 pounds climb ladders and be able to work prone or standing for limited durations.
  • Ability to effectively communicate both verbally and in writing with the Engineering Team and Program Teams while multi-tasking between the requirements and deadlines of multiple programs
  • Maintain vigorous ESD protection procedures

Desired:

  • Previous leadership experience.
  • ISO9001 or AS9100 QMS experience.
  • IPC 620 experience
